OBJECT POSITIONING SYSTEM
20180250557 · 2018-09-06 ·

A system and device system for controlling a height of a levitated object based on a height selection made by a user. The system includes a user input device configured to receive the height selection made by the user, a base in communication with the user input device, and a power source. The base includes a magnet array having a central electromagnet configured to exert an adjustable magnetic force in a first direction, a plurality of peripheral electromagnets each being configured to exert an adjustable magnetic force in the first direction, and a permanent magnet being configured to exert a non-adjustable magnet force in a second direction at least substantially opposite the first direction. The power source is configured to deliver an adjustable current to the magnet array, such that adjustment of the current controls the levitation height of the object.

Height-adjustable golf tee system
12138514 · 2024-11-12 · ·

An adjustable height golf tee system having a tee and an anchor is discussed. The tee is height-adjustable relative to the anchor. A first anchor includes a cap, a stem, and a tip. The stem can be threaded internally, externally, or a combination thereof. A second anchor includes a base, a first stem, a cap, and a second stem as well as optional spacers. The stems can be threaded internally. Both the first and second anchors can be composed multiple pieces (e.g., a detachable cap, a detachable stem, or a detachable portion thereof) to provide access to an inner cavity of the respective stems.

EXTENDABLE GOLF TEE
20250001268 · 2025-01-02 ·

Apparatuses, systems, and methods are disclosed for an extendable golf tee. An extendable golf tee includes a ball support, a shaft, and extension member coupling the ball support to the shaft, wherein the ball support, the shaft, or a combination thereof are movable along the extension member to set a length of the apparatus from the ball support to an end of the shaft at a predefined length.

Adjustable golf tee
09737773 · 2017-08-22 ·

A telescoping golf ball tee with an internal locking mechanism is provided. The internal locking mechanism permits the golf ball tee neck to adjust to a desired height while still supporting the weight of a golf ball. Upon impact, a bowl-like member at the base of the golf ball tee neck is forced into a cavity in the golf ball tee base which, in turn, applies force to the golf ball tee neck which prevents the neck from escaping the base.
